**Q: Why are telemetry payloads from Glimmerbox devices so big, and can we shrink them?**

Yep! The collector supports zstd compression out of the box — most customers just haven't flipped the flag. Enabling it typically cuts payload size by 70% with no data loss. Walk them through the `compression: auto` setting first. Full steps and the rollback notes live on our internal page here:

wiki page, fajof-tajef: https://vault.tolvaqio.corp/board/pipeline/pages/ticket/c20d7f984bcc9e12

Ticket: Staging env misconfigured for Siftgate bloom filter

The bloom layer in front of the Pellet KV store is rejecting all lookups in staging because the env file was copied from the dev template without credentials. False-positive tuning values are fine; only the auth line is missing. To unblock the weekly demo, the Pellet admission secret must be set on the following line.

env line for yaguf-fajop: LEDGER_TOKEN13=fb08984397349

## Artifact Signing — Perf Note

Heads up for the security review: template rendering in the Copperfen build portal was eating ~400ms per signed artifact page because we re-verified signatures on every render. We now cache verified manifests per build, cutting render time to 30ms. Verification still happens once, promise. For reference, the key used to sign manifests is listed below.

release key, fahaf-bajof: bky3_Xam

# Env file — Cartwheel dispatch, driver-assignment heuristic
# Scope: staging only. Do not promote to prod.
# The heuristic weights (proximity, shift balance, refusal rate) are tuned
# for the Velmont pilot region and will misbehave elsewhere.
# Review notes: heuristic service runs unprivileged; it reads weights
# read-only from the tuning store and writes nothing back.
# Only one sensitive value exists in this file: the tuning-store access
# credential, consumed at boot and never logged.
# That credential is set on the following line.

secret setting of faduf-bahop: LEDGER_TOKEN8=c3b363be